Limelight /

Set in London, in 1914, the film stars Chaplin as an aging music hall comic who's convinced he can no longer move people to laughter. But he gets a final opportunity to shine when he saves a young, equally desperate ballet dancer (Bloom) from suicide, then guides her to triumph on the stage.
